English domiciled students
Tuition fees
Students normally domiciled in England, will have a Fee Status of Home-RUK.
If you are a full-time, first degree student you may be eligible to apply for a Tuition Fee Loan to cover the full cost of your programme of study from Student Finance England. Tuition Fee Loans are non-means tested and paid directly to the institution by the Student Loan Company.

Government loans and grants
Non-repayable Maintenance Grants up to £3,353 are available to students with an annual household income of £42,611 or less.
Maintenance loans are also available to cover the cost of living away from home. The maximum Maintenance Loan for new student starting in September 2013 is £5,500.

Student support will be assessed with Tuition Fee Loan eligibility in a single application to Student Finance England.
Repayments
From 2012, repayments on Tuition Fee and Maintenance Loans will start in teh April after you graduate or leave University, provided you are earning over £21,000 a year.
